WHY not be part of the Lancashire Day celebratio­ns this weekend?

If you were born between the river Duddon to the north and the river Mersey to the south you are offically a Lancastria­n. This is because no legislatio­n changed the county boundaries.

The Grasshoppe­r bar in Sandon Road, Hillside, will be dedicating this day to two great Lancastria­n lasses – Jean Alexander (1926-2016) and Victoria Wood (1953– 2016).

Guests can also enjoy Lancashire hotpot, a fun themed quiz, the Lancashire Day proclamati­on, and a toast to the Duke of Lancaster.

All proceeds from raffle quiz and food will be donated to the Hillside Christmas Decoration­s Fund.

Raffle prizes include a large luxury hamper of local goodies, a hamper of Lancashire ales, two tickets for a Southport Football Club match, or two tickets for a cricket fixture at S&B in Southport.
